Posts Tagged ‘Jhorror’

Jhorror: Inugami

According to that bastion of all questionably accurate information, Wikipedia, an Inugami is the angry, disembodied spirit of a dog which attaches itself to human master and, for the most part, acts on the master’s wishes. Folklore suggests that some rather despicable cruelty, resulting in the death of the chosen dog, will allow the dog’s […]

Continue Reading...